Biography of Maluma
Maluma, born Juan Luis Londoño Arias on January 28, 1994, in Medellín, Colombia, is a globally recognized singer, songwriter, and actor. He rose to fame in the Latin music scene with his unique blend of reggaeton, pop, and urban sounds. Maluma's charismatic personality and captivating music have earned him a massive fan base worldwide, making him one of the most influential artists of his generation.

Maluma's Career Highlights
Maluma's career has been nothing short of extraordinary. He began his journey in the music industry at the age of 16, releasing his debut single "Farandulera" in 2010. The song quickly gained traction, paving the way for his first studio album, *Magia*, released in 2012. Since then, Maluma has released several chart-topping albums, including *Pretty Boy, Dirty Boy* (2015), *F.A.M.E.* (2018), and *Papi Juancho* (2020).
Some of his most notable achievements include:
- Winning multiple Latin Grammy Awards and Billboard Latin Music Awards.
- Collaborating with global superstars like Shakira, Madonna, and The Weeknd.
- Becoming the youngest artist to simultaneously hold both the #1 and #2 spots on Billboard's Latin Airplay chart.
- Expanding his reach into acting with a role in the film *Marry Me* (2022).
Impact on the Music Industry
Maluma's influence extends beyond his music. He has played a pivotal role in popularizing reggaeton and Latin urban music on a global scale. His collaborations with international artists have helped bridge cultural gaps and introduce Latin music to new audiences worldwide.

How Misinformation Spreads Online
Misinformation spreads rapidly on the internet due to several factors:
- Social Media Algorithms: Platforms prioritize content that generates high engagement, even if it's false.
- Emotional Appeal: Sensational headlines and shocking claims are more likely to be shared.
- Lack of Fact-Checking: Many users share content without verifying its accuracy.
According to a study by MIT, false news stories are 70% more likely to be retweeted than true stories. This highlights the importance of being vigilant and critical when consuming online content.
